Searched refs:semid_kernel (Results 1 – 9 of 9) sorted by relevance
| /f-stack/freebsd/security/mac/ |
| H A D | mac_sysv_sem.c | 75 mac_sysvsem_init(struct semid_kernel *semakptr) in mac_sysvsem_init() 93 mac_sysvsem_destroy(struct semid_kernel *semakptr) in mac_sysvsem_destroy() 103 mac_sysvsem_create(struct ucred *cred, struct semid_kernel *semakptr) in mac_sysvsem_create() 111 mac_sysvsem_cleanup(struct semid_kernel *semakptr) in mac_sysvsem_cleanup() 121 mac_sysvsem_check_semctl(struct ucred *cred, struct semid_kernel *semakptr, in mac_sysvsem_check_semctl() 137 mac_sysvsem_check_semget(struct ucred *cred, struct semid_kernel *semakptr) in mac_sysvsem_check_semget() 151 mac_sysvsem_check_semop(struct ucred *cred, struct semid_kernel *semakptr, in mac_sysvsem_check_semop()
|
| H A D | mac_framework.h | 77 struct semid_kernel; 397 struct semid_kernel *semakptr, int cmd); 399 struct semid_kernel *semakptr); 401 struct semid_kernel *semakptr, size_t accesstype); 402 void mac_sysvsem_cleanup(struct semid_kernel *semakptr); 404 struct semid_kernel *semakptr); 405 void mac_sysvsem_destroy(struct semid_kernel *); 406 void mac_sysvsem_init(struct semid_kernel *);
|
| H A D | mac_policy.h | 91 struct semid_kernel; 513 struct semid_kernel *semakptr, struct label *semaklabel, 516 struct semid_kernel *semakptr, struct label *semaklabel); 518 struct semid_kernel *semakptr, struct label *semaklabel, 522 struct semid_kernel *semakptr, struct label *semalabel);
|
| /f-stack/freebsd/sys/ |
| H A D | sem.h | 128 struct semid_kernel { struct
|
| /f-stack/freebsd/kern/ |
| H A D | sysv_sem.c | 92 struct semid_kernel *semakptr); 95 static int sem_prison_cansee(struct prison *, struct semid_kernel *); 119 static struct semid_kernel *sema; /* semaphore id pool */ 283 sema = malloc(sizeof(struct semid_kernel) * seminfo.semmni, M_SEM, in seminit() 546 semvalid(int semid, struct prison *rpr, struct semid_kernel *semakptr) in semvalid() 557 struct semid_kernel *semakptr; in sem_remove() 613 sem_prison_cansee(struct prison *rpr, struct semid_kernel *semakptr) in sem_prison_cansee() 701 struct semid_kernel *semakptr; in kern_semctl() 1107 struct semid_kernel *semakptr; in sys_semop() 1422 struct semid_kernel *semakptr; in semexit_myhook() [all …]
|
| /f-stack/freebsd/security/mac_stub/ |
| H A D | mac_stub.c | 1238 stub_sysvsem_check_semctl(struct ucred *cred, struct semid_kernel *semakptr, in stub_sysvsem_check_semctl() 1246 stub_sysvsem_check_semget(struct ucred *cred, struct semid_kernel *semakptr, in stub_sysvsem_check_semget() 1254 stub_sysvsem_check_semop(struct ucred *cred, struct semid_kernel *semakptr, in stub_sysvsem_check_semop() 1268 stub_sysvsem_create(struct ucred *cred, struct semid_kernel *semakptr, in stub_sysvsem_create()
|
| /f-stack/freebsd/security/mac_biba/ |
| H A D | mac_biba.c | 2633 biba_sysvsem_check_semctl(struct ucred *cred, struct semid_kernel *semakptr, in biba_sysvsem_check_semctl() 2671 biba_sysvsem_check_semget(struct ucred *cred, struct semid_kernel *semakptr, in biba_sysvsem_check_semget() 2689 biba_sysvsem_check_semop(struct ucred *cred, struct semid_kernel *semakptr, in biba_sysvsem_check_semop() 2719 biba_sysvsem_create(struct ucred *cred, struct semid_kernel *semakptr, in biba_sysvsem_create()
|
| /f-stack/freebsd/security/mac_mls/ |
| H A D | mac_mls.c | 2266 mls_sysvsem_check_semctl(struct ucred *cred, struct semid_kernel *semakptr, in mls_sysvsem_check_semctl() 2304 mls_sysvsem_check_semget(struct ucred *cred, struct semid_kernel *semakptr, in mls_sysvsem_check_semget() 2322 mls_sysvsem_check_semop(struct ucred *cred, struct semid_kernel *semakptr, in mls_sysvsem_check_semop() 2352 mls_sysvsem_create(struct ucred *cred, struct semid_kernel *semakptr, in mls_sysvsem_create()
|
| /f-stack/freebsd/security/mac_test/ |
| H A D | mac_test.c | 2255 struct semid_kernel *semakptr, struct label *semaklabel, int cmd) in test_sysvsem_check_semctl() 2268 struct semid_kernel *semakptr, struct label *semaklabel) in test_sysvsem_check_semget() 2281 struct semid_kernel *semakptr, struct label *semaklabel, size_t accesstype) in test_sysvsem_check_semop() 2302 test_sysvsem_create(struct ucred *cred, struct semid_kernel *semakptr, in test_sysvsem_create()
|